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ification in Your Home

Are you experiencing any of the following warning signs in your home? If so, it may be time to call in the professionals for Industrial Dehumidification.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Is your home filled with musty odors that refuse to disappear? This could be a sign of hidden moisture issues that need to be addressed.

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ling

Have you noticed water stains on your walls or ceiling? This could show a leak or other moisture issue that needs to be fixed.

Peeling Paint or Warped Flooring

Is your paint peeling or your flooring warped? This could be a sign of excessive moisture that’s causing damage to your home’s surfaces.

Mold Growth on Your Walls or Ceiling

Have you spotted mold growth on your walls or ceiling? This is a serious issue that needs immediate attention to prevent health risks and further damage.

High Humidity Levels in Your Home

Are you experiencing high humidity levels in your home? This can lead to a range of issues, from musty odors to mold growth.

Water Damage from a Leaky Pipe or Appliance

Have you experienced water damage from a leaky pipe or appliance? This is a serious issue that needs prompt attention to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Industrial Dehumidification v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small moisture issue in a single room Yes No DIY solutions like fans and dehumidifiers can often handle small issues.
Large moisture issue affecting multiple rooms No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to handle large-scale moisture issues.
Hidden moisture issue behind walls or in ceilings No Yes DIY solutions can’t reach hidden areas, and professional equipment is needed to detect and fix the issue.
Mold growth in a high-traffic area No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to safely remove mold and prevent further growth.
Water damage from a leaky pipe or appliance No Yes Professional help is needed to fix the leak, dry out the area, and prevent further damage.
High humidity levels in a large commercial space No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to handle large-scale humidity issues in commercial spaces.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Charleston Park, FL

The cost of Industrial Dehumidification services can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Charleston Park, FL. But, our team will work clos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s involved and that we’re working within your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$200 – $500 The severity of the issue and the size of the affected area.
Equipment Setup and Installation $500 – $2,000 The type and quantity of equipment needed.
Dehumidification and Monitoring $100 – $500 per day The duration of the dehumidification process and the complexity of the issue.
Cleanup and Restoration $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for restoration.
Water Damage Repair $1,000 – $5,000 The severity of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Mold Remediation $500 – $2,000 The extent of the mold growth and the materials needed for remediation.
